Old Owens are an amateur old boys club formed in 1891 in Islington London and were set up to provide senior mens football for those who attended the school. The club has since moved to Potters Bar in Hertfordshire, via Whetstone in North London and now have become an open club catering for Men's football of all standards.
The club currently operates 5 Saturday sides and compete in various AFA affiliated competitions in and around London. All 5 sides play in the Southern Amateur League, The AFA Cup, The Old Boys Cup and the SAL trophies.
The club also provides regular vets football for over 35's.
